Runbook: Sweepline Release Step 4 — Orphaned-Resource Sweeper. After the Harkwell cluster upgrade, deploy the sweeper before re-enabling autoscaling so it can reclaim volumes and dangling load balancers left by the old scheduler. The sweeper runs in dry-run mode for the first hour; review its candidate list before flipping to enforce. All sweeper binaries must be verified against the release manifest prior to rollout, per the Dunmere security baseline. Verification and manifest signing for this release use the key below.

release key, hadug-kawef: bky13_mPGeFZeR1GZ1G

**Onboarding: Thumbnail Queue (Pixelmoor)**

The Pixelmoor thumbnail queue drains through three workers; backlogs over 10k items page the on-call. Stuck jobs get requeued automatically after fifteen minutes. For the weekly sync, note that manually flushing the dead-letter lane requires admin recovery, and the approval step prompts for the passphrase printed below.

unlock words, kagef-taduf: fenir-quenix-norwyn-sorvan-gormir-gorir-fraok

Runbook: Gustline weather-alert fan-out recovery

If fan-out lag on the Gustline alert dispatcher exceeds five minutes, pause the ingest consumer, drain the retry queue, and restart the dispatcher pods in order. Verify delivery by issuing a test alert against the staging fan-out endpoint before resuming ingest. The internal key used to authenticate against the dispatcher service is below.

app token of hahig-fawip = vxb4-lyC2

**Mgmt Meeting Minutes — Retiring the Brightline Range**

Quick recap for sales leads at Fenholt Supplies: we agreed to retire the Brightline fixture range by year-end. Remaining stock moves to clearance pricing next month, and accounts on standing orders get migrated to the Lumetta range. Trade-in incentives were approved in principle. The confidential note on next steps sits just below.

board note of bajof-bajeg: The pricing group signed off on a budget of $13.4 million for Project Sildor. The renewal with Lamixek Holdings closes at $48.9 million a year, 49 percent above the last contract.